R. B. Hickman is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Geoph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, R. B. Hickman has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 349 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 2 papers in Geophysics. Recurrent topics in R. B. Hickman's work include earthquake and tectonic studies (2 papers), Material Dynamics and Properties (2 papers) and Phase Equilibria and Thermodynamics (2 papers). R. B. Hickman is often cited by papers focused on earthquake and tectonic studies (2 papers), Material Dynamics and Properties (2 papers) and Phase Equilibria and Thermodynamics (2 papers). R. B. Hickman collaborates with scholars based in United States and Australia. R. B. Hickman's co-authors include Anthony J. C. Ladd, William G. Hoover, Denis J. Evans, W. T. Ashurst, Bill Moran, Brad Lee Holian, R.M. Scanlan and J. Zbasnik and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Quantitative Spectroscopy and Radiative Transfer, Physical review. A, General physics and ACM SIGNUM Newsletter.
